1. A one way door animal excluder comprising:
an elongated enclosure provided with openings at a front end and a rear end, respectively, and a ceiling, the enclosure defining a passageway for an animal;
a door pivotally attached to the ceiling of the enclosure, the door being movable between an open position that allows passage of a target animal through the passageway and a closed position that prevents passage of the target animal through the passageway;
a torsion spring configured to engage the door, the torsion spring including a coil and first and second arms, respectively, extending radially from the coil; and
a top plate secured to the ceiling of the enclosure;
wherein the coil is held to the top plate such that the torsion spring biases the door toward the closed position,
wherein the top plate is provided with a plurality of flanges, and wherein at least one of the plurality of flanges is crimped to the ceiling of the enclosure to secure the top plate to the enclosure,
wherein the top plate comprises a mandrel formed by at least two opposed tabs extending into an opening provided in the top plate, the at least two tabs being truncated and having an elongated gap there between, and
wherein the at least two opposed tabs extend into opposed open ends of the coil such that the spring is held to the top plate by the mandrel.
